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

Penyffordd station is a charming spot, characterized by its simplicity. The station does not have a ticket office or machines, so travelers are recommended to purchase tickets online or via mobile for convenience. What it lacks in commercial facilities such as shops and ATMs, Penyffordd makes up for with its accessibility features. Highlights include step-free access to both platforms through ramps and gates, making traveling a bit easier for those with mobility needs. Moreover, an induction loop is available for hearing aid users.

Despite the absence of CCTV, public Wi-Fi, and other typical amenities, the calm environment is perfect for those who enjoy an uncomplicated travel experience. For any queries or assistance, passengers can reach out to the customer relations team at Transport for Wales via their website. Additionally, there's a helpline available to reassure travelers needing extra support or guidance during their journey.

Transport Connectivity

Getting around from Penyffordd station is straightforward thanks to local bus services readily available nearby. The bus stops are conveniently located in the village center outside the Red Lion Pub, providing straightforward access to different parts of the area. Although bicycle hire is not available at the station itself, cyclists can find dedicated bicycle parking in the station car park, facilitating an easy blend of traveling by train and cycling.

For those times when rail replacement services are necessary, travelers will find the bus stop for such services within the station car park. This coordination helps ensure that onward journeys are as smooth as possible during disruptions.

Everything you need to know about Gatley Station

Welcome to Gatley Train Station

Gatley Train Station serves as a small but essential gateway in the village of Gatley, located in the Metropolitan Borough of Stockport in Greater Manchester, England. This convenient transit hub connects residents and visitors to the greater Manchester area and beyond. Whether you're a daily commuter or an occasional traveler, let’s explore all the essentials you need to maximize your experience at this station.

Facilities and Accessibility

Gatley Train Station may be compact, yet it efficiently caters to the needs of its patrons. Operating a practical timetable, the ticket office opens from 06:20 to 12:50 on weekdays and slightly shorter hours over the weekend. Despite the lack of a ticket office presence on Sundays, travelers can still purchase their fares using the available ticket machines. While collecting tickets bought online remains hassle-free, it's notable to mention that accessible ticket machines are currently unavailable.

In terms of accessibility, Gatley Station is categorized as a Category B station, which means that while there is step-free access, it may not be available throughout. Note that there are ramps with gentle slopes available for access to the platforms. Travelers requiring assistance can utilize the helpline at 0800 200 6060 for additional support.

Onward Travel Options

Navigating beyond Gatley is convenient with readily accessible local transport options. For those seeking onward travel by bus, handy services are available from nearby bus stops on Gatley Road. Rail replacement services follow a similar route, providing links to Manchester Piccadilly and Manchester Airport. Additionally, taxis can be arranged through resources available online, ensuring seamless transitions from train to taxi rides.

While bicycle storage isn't offered at this particular station, printed information on onward journey planning is easily accessible, making transitions to other transport modes smooth and efficient.
